Drug candidates target obesity, metabolic and endocrine disorders. The pipeline spans injectable and oral VK2735, plus VK2809, VK0214, VK5211 and DACRA programs.

Clinical development focuses on metabolic and endocrine therapies, led by injectable and oral VK2735 for obesity. Other named programs include VK2809 for lipid and metabolic disorders, VK0214 for X-linked adrenoleukodystrophy, VK5211, and DACRA candidates for obesity and metabolic disease.

Viking is a clinical-stage biopharmaceutical company based in San Diego, with subsidiaries in Australia and Ireland and worldwide rights to several Ligand assets. Its pipeline combines licensed technology with internally developed programs.

Clinical trials and regulatory interactions shape program advancement. Viking has a manufacturing and supply agreement for VK2735 and is building commercial capabilities. Several program assets remain materially dependent on Ligand licenses.
